On Fri, Oct 19, 2018 at 9:50 PM Du Changbin [off-list ref] wrote:
The level4_kernel_pgt is only defined when X86_5LEVEL is enabled. So
surround level4_kernel_pgt with #ifdef CONFIG_X86_5LEVEL...#endif to
make code correct.
For clarification, is it better to mention
that this is a preparation for CONFIG_CC_OPTIMIZE_FOR_DEBUGGING ?

Hmm, this code looks a bit ugly...

Does the following one liner work with CONFIG_CC_OPTIMIZE_FOR_DEBUGGING ?

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/head64.c b/arch/x86/kernel/head64.c
index 8047379..579847f 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/head64.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/head64.c
@@ -97,7 +97,7 @@ static bool __head check_la57_support(unsigned long physaddr)
        return true;
 }
 #else
-static bool __head check_la57_support(unsigned long physaddr)
+static __always_inline bool __head check_la57_support(unsigned long physaddr)
 {
        return false;
 }
